So, long story short, my Hemi let a valve seat get loose and destroyed itself a few Saturdays ago. Here i sit a week and a half layer with a new remanufactured engine in my Ram.
The folks that replaced my engine recommended I keep out of higher RPM's ( gave no magic number to stay below) for 3000 miles, and to also not tow anything in those 3000 miles. They recommend changing the oil at 3000 miles as well. I've read from other places where on a new engine, folks recommend changing the oil fairly quick at like 500-1000 miles. Does anyone have any other tips on breaking it in right?
Also, the jokers put 10W-30 oil in the truck, in spite of the clear indication on the oil cap that it wants 5W-20. Is it OK to use that oil until i change it , or should i change it out for the right stuff asap?
